Description:You will be the Software Quality Test Engineer for our team in Grand Prairie, TX. Our team is responsible for developing and maintaining Software Quality Engineering (SQE) Common Processes that align with AS9100 Quality Management System, Capability Maturity Model-Integrated (CMMI), and program requirements.
What You Will Be Doing
As the Software Quality Test Engineer, you will be responsible for ensuring the quality of our software testing processes and equipment, collaborating with cross-functional teams to identify and resolve issues, and driving compliance with contractual and company requirements. You will focus on test engineering, test equipment, and test stations, working closely with test engineering, systems/software development personnel, and program team members.
Your responsibilities will include:
-Focusing on test equipment and test sets, working directly with test engineering and program teams
-Identifying root causes and corrective actions, performing process/product evaluations, and participating in program activities
-Evaluating data to identify systemic test equipment issues and trends
-Participating in peer reviews of software and test equipment requirements, design, and documentation
-Collaborating with software suppliers and participating in testing events of test stations

Basic Qualifications:
• STEM degree, preferably in one of the following disciplines: Computer Science, Computer Engineering, Electrical Engineering or Mechanical Engineering.
• Ability to interpret Schematic Drawings and Specifications, that will enable test equipment development.
• Understanding of Systems & Software and Test Equipment Processes including Performance Metrics.
• Experience in Requirements, Design, Code and Proof & Validation (P&V) Testing.
• Demonstrated ability to use causal analysis tools to analyze and resolve technical/process issues varying from basic to very complex.
• Ability to interpret LabView and Test Stand code.
• Test Equipment Hardware knowledge or background skills.
• Effective Communication Skills: Written, Oral, Listening, Presentation and Technical Writing.
• Effective interpersonal skills, including Team building and Collaboration.
• Proficient skill level with Microsoft Office applications: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Access, etc.
• Ability to travel (LM sites, suppliers, testing sites, etc.)
• Ability to obtain a security clearance
Desired Skills:
• ASQ CSQE (Certified Software Quality Engineer)
• Strong knowledge of Industry recognized Quality systems/models such as Capability Maturity Model Integrated (CMMI), International (ISO), aerospace (AS), and FAA regulation
• Lean / Six Sigma Green or Black Belt Certified
• Experience with Software Suppliers support of test stations.
• Experience with Government customers
• In-depth knowledge of test stations/test sets including validation, verification and certification.
• Strong knowledge of LabView and Test Stand
